Corrupt former French Minister jailed

Former French Foreign Minister Roland Dumas was jailed for six months today at the end of multi-million pound corruption trial that has enthralled the nation.

The 78-year-old former minister was charged with receiving illegal funds from the state-owned Elf Aquitaine oil company between 1989 and 1992 while he was foreign minister.

The Paris court also handed Dumas a two-year suspended sentence.
